如何给云服务器装软件
-
给云服务器装软件通常有两种方法,一种是通过命令行安装,另一种是通过图形界面安装。下面我将详细介绍这两种方法。
一、通过命令行安装软件
-
登录云服务器
使用SSH工具(如PuTTY)登录到云服务器,输入用户名和密码进行登录。 -
更新系统
登录成功后,首先需要更新系统软件包。运行以下命令来更新软件包列表并安装更新:
sudo apt update sudo apt upgrade- 寻找软件包
使用以下命令来搜索你需要安装的软件包:
sudo apt search 软件包名称例如,要搜索Node.js软件包,可以运行:
sudo apt search nodejs- 安装软件包
找到需要安装的软件包后,使用以下命令进行安装:
sudo apt install 软件包名称例如,要安装Node.js软件包,可以运行:
sudo apt install nodejs- 验证安装
安装完成后,可以使用以下命令验证软件包是否成功安装:
软件包名称 --version例如,要验证Node.js是否成功安装,可以运行:
node --version如果成功安装,将会显示相应的版本号信息。
二、通过图形界面安装软件
-
连接云服务器
通过远程桌面连接工具(如Windows远程桌面)连接到云服务器。输入服务器的IP地址和用户名密码进行连接。 -
安装远程桌面环境
如果你的云服务器上没有安装远程桌面环境,需要先安装一个。可以使用以下命令来安装Xfce桌面环境:
sudo apt install xfce4-
安装远程桌面连接工具
在本地计算机上安装一个远程桌面连接工具,例如Windows远程桌面或VNC Viewer。 -
连接云服务器
使用远程桌面连接工具连接到服务器的IP地址。 -
打开软件包管理器
在远程桌面环境下,打开软件包管理器(如Ubuntu的Software Center、Debian的Synaptic Package Manager等)。 -
搜索软件包
在软件包管理器中,使用搜索功能找到你需要安装的软件包。 -
安装软件包
找到软件包后,点击安装按钮进行安装。
总结:
通过命令行安装软件更加方便和快速,尤其适用于熟悉命令行界面的用户和批量安装多个软件包的情况。而通过图形界面安装软件更加适合对命令行不太熟悉或喜欢使用图形界面的用户。无论选择哪种方式,都可以在云服务器上轻松安装所需的软件。1年前 -
-
给云服务器安装软件有以下几个步骤:
-
登录服务器:使用SSH协议通过命令行登录到云服务器。你需要提供服务器的IP地址和登录凭证(用户名和密码或私钥)。
-
更新系统:登录到服务器后,首先运行以下命令,以确保系统是最新的:
sudo apt update sudo apt upgrade如果你使用的是其他操作系统,可以使用相应的命令更新系统。
-
安装所需软件:确定你需要安装的软件,并找到相应的安装方法。常见的安装软件的方式有以下几种:
-
包管理器:大多数Linux服务器都使用了包管理器来管理软件包的安装。不同的Linux发行版有不同的包管理器,如apt、yum和dnf等。使用适当的包管理器安装所需软件,例如:
sudo apt install 软件包名 -
源代码安装:有些软件包可能无法通过包管理器直接安装,需要进行源代码编译安装。下载源代码,并按照提供的说明进行编译和安装。
-
虚拟环境:对于一些开发和测试工作,你可能需要在独立的虚拟环境中安装软件。虚拟环境可以隔离不同项目之间的软件依赖关系。常见的虚拟环境工具有Virtualenv和Conda等。
-
-
配置软件:安装完软件后,可能需要进行一些配置才能正常使用。阅读软件的官方文档或安装指南,了解如何进行配置。
-
测试软件:在使用软件之前,应该对其进行测试,以确保一切正常。按照软件的使用文档进行测试,并确保软件能够正常运行。
在给云服务器装软件时,需要注意以下几点:
-
了解软件的安装要求:不同的软件有不同的安装要求,例如依赖库、硬件要求等。在安装软件之前,先了解所需软件的安装要求,以确保服务器满足这些要求。
-
安全性考虑:在安装软件时,要考虑服务器的安全性。只安装必要的软件,并定期更新软件以修补安全漏洞。
-
资源利用:考虑服务器的资源利用情况,避免安装过多的软件。不必要的软件会占用服务器资源,导致性能下降。
-
可维护性:考虑软件的可维护性,选择易于管理和维护的软件。选择受支持的、有活跃社区的软件,以便获得支持和更新。
-
文档和教程:在安装软件之前,先查阅软件的官方文档和教程。这些文档通常提供了详细的安装和配置指南,以及一些常见问题的解决方案。
总结:给云服务器装软件需要登录服务器,更新系统,通过包管理器安装或源代码编译安装软件,配置软件并进行测试。另外,还需要考虑安全性、资源利用、可维护性,并查阅官方文档和教程以获得更多指导。
1年前 -
-
给云服务器安装软件可以通过以下步骤进行:
-
登录到云服务器
首先,你需要通过SSH(Secure Shell)登录到云服务器。在登录前,请确保你已获得云服务器的登录信息,包括IP地址和用户名/密码。 -
更新服务器
在安装软件之前,建议先更新服务器的操作系统和软件包。使用以下命令更新系统:
sudo apt update sudo apt upgrade针对不同的操作系统,如Ubuntu、CentOS等,使用相应的更新命令。
-
确定软件源
软件源是一个包含软件包的远程存储库。你可以从官方软件源或其他第三方软件源中下载软件。在选择软件源之前,请确保软件源的可靠性和安全。 -
安装软件
使用包管理器安装软件。对于Ubuntu、Debian等系统,使用apt命令安装软件。例如,要安装Apache Web服务器,可以使用以下命令:
sudo apt install apache2对于CentOS等系统,使用yum命令安装软件。例如,要安装Nginx,可以使用以下命令:
sudo yum install nginx要安装其他软件,请将相应软件的名称替换为上述示例中的软件名称。
-
配置软件
安装软件后,你可能需要根据自己的需求进行相应的配置。配置文件通常位于/etc目录下,你可以使用文本编辑器(如vi、nano等)进行编辑。根据软件的不同,配置文件的位置和内容也会有所不同。 -
启动和停止软件
安装完成后,你可以使用相应的命令启动或停止软件。例如,要启动Apache Web服务器,可以使用以下命令:
sudo systemctl start apache2要停止Nginx,可以使用以下命令:
sudo systemctl stop nginx-
开放端口或配置防火墙
如果你的软件需要监听网络连接(如Web服务器、数据库等),则需要开放相应的端口或配置防火墙以允许流量通过。你可以使用防火墙工具(如ufw、firewalld等)或云服务提供商的防火墙规则设置来完成。 -
完成安装
完成上述步骤后,你已成功将软件安装在云服务器上。你可以通过浏览器、命令行等方式访问并使用安装的软件。
总结:
给云服务器安装软件的步骤包括登录服务器、更新系统、选择软件源、安装软件、配置软件、启动和停止软件、开放端口或配置防火墙。根据不同的操作系统和软件,具体操作可能会有所不同。1年前 -